#13022b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13022b is composed of 7.5% red, 0.8%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.8% cyan, 95.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 83.1% black. It has a hue angle of 264.9 degrees, a saturation of 91.1% and a lightness of 8.8%. #13022b color hex could be obtained by blending #260456 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#13022b color description : Very dark (mostly black) violet.
#13022b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#13022b has RGB values of R:19, G:2, B:43 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.83. Its decimal value is 1245739.

Shades and Tints of #13022b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020006 is the darkest color, while #f7f2fe is the lightest one.
